The Impact of Digital Piracy on Indian Cinema: A Case Study of MovieRulz and 'Dear Comrade'
Movierulz.com is a website that has been operational for several years, providing links to pirated copies of movies in various languages, including Telugu. The website has gained a massive following in India, particularly among young audiences who are looking for easy access to movies without paying for them. However, this has come at a significant cost to the film industry, which has seen substantial losses due to piracy.
